Originally posted by jambo
Right, I want to spend about £300, and in the running is Pioneer 545 and Sony DVPNS700. Audio playback is an issue as well as watching da movies.
opinions please?
If you`re concerned about audio cd playback, then consider the Marantz DV4100OSE or DV4200. The Pioneer has the edge over the sony for audio replay. However, also consider the Panasonic DVDRA61 and Pioneer DV636A as both these models have DVD-A rather then sonys SACD... I personally have a Sony DVPS9000ES and prefer the sound of DVD-A discs, rather then SACD, but geta demo and see which is for you :)
